Kala Namak (Black Salt) - 6 oz. Jar
Black Salt is used in Indian cuisine as a condiment and is added to chaats, chutneys, raitas and many other savory Indian snacks.

Kala Namak or Black Salt is a special type of Indian mineral salt. It is actually pinkish grey rather than black and has a very distinctiive sulfurous mineral taste (like hard boiled egg yolks).
